    Strengths: Easy to transport. Pretty light.Well designed. Accomondates the high-capacity battery that buldges out from the back of the laptop.Easy to un-dock the laptop.

    Weaknesses:Seems too "light" and flimsy.Hard to tell if you've got the latptop fully latched in place on the dock.Only ONE USB port!

    Overall Evaluation: This an awesome alternative to buying the Thinkpad Mini-Dock. The only difference is that the Port Replicator only has ONE USB port at the back, though you are still able to use the laptop's USB ports.I have a T42, and I am able to use this almost as a desktop replacement. I have two 19" TFT's that I plug into the Port Replicator's VGA and DVI ports and I am able to span my desktop across the two external monitors. The laptop LCD is disabled.I have my keyboard and mouse plugged into it, along with my printer. Great as a desktop replacement!However, I needed to buy a USB hub for additional USB ports.
